for i in range(3.0): TypeError: 'float' object cannot be interpreted as an integer In the above example, we did not perform any arithmetic operations. Suppose you want to print a specific sequence of numbers such as 1,2,3,4 and 5. Etsi töitä, jotka liittyvät hakusanaan Python range float tai palkkaa maailman suurimmalta makkinapaikalta, jossa on yli 18 miljoonaa työtä. It doesn’t refer to Python float. You have to use the int() function of Python. Python float() with Examples. range() Parameters. The argument dtype=float here translates to NumPy float64, that is np.float. 9 responses; Oldest; Nested; Kent Johnson You can't generate all the float values in a range. … >>> from math import pi >>> pi. The Python float() method converts a number stored in a string or integer into a floating point number, or a number with a decimal point. The range() function generates a sequence of numbers from start up to stop, and increments by step. This means that we should not convert total_sales to a float. Leave a Reply Cancel reply. Python Code Screenshot. Pass the float variable as the argument of the int() function in Python. The problem in our code is that we’re trying to create a range using a floating-point number. It's free to sign up and bid on jobs. If you face difficulty in Python number types, please comment. So, to generate Range of floating point numbers, we have to either workaround range() function to generate sequence of floating point numbers. To print the resulted integer value after conversion, you have to use the Python print() function. Note: it is possible to round the sum (see also Floating Point Arithmetic: Issues and Limitations): >>> round(sum(l),1) 12.4 Iterate through the list: Example using a for loop: >>> list = [1,2,3,4] >>> tot = 0 >>> for i in list:... tot = tot + i... >>> tot 10 Sum a list including different types of elements. Division operator / accepts two arguments and performs float division. When you need a floating-point dtype with lower precision and size (in bytes), you can explicitly specify that: >>> Usage . Round(float_num, Num_of_decimals) is a built-in function available with python. Here floatnumber is the form of a Python floating-point literal, described in Floating point literals. float_num: the float number to be rounded. Convert float to hex in Python; One response to “Print floats to a specific number of decimal points in Python” murali says: August 4, 2020 at 4:40 pm . Approach 1: List data. range function in python cannot take float number as a step value. (OK, you probably could, but it would not be practical or useful.) Python Convert Float to Integer Using int() If you want to convert float to integer variable type in Python. The range() function is a built-in-function u sed in python, it is used to generate a sequence of numbers.If the user wants to generate a sequence of numbers given the starting and the ending values then they can give these values as parameters of the range() function. This is because we need a number to create a range using the range() statement. Definition. In Python range() tutorial, we have seen that we can create an iterable for a sequence of integers. The first argument of the format() should be the float variable which you want to convert. Note that this is in the very nature of binary floating-point: this is not a bug in Python, and it is not a bug in your code either. In our code, we convert “total_sales” to a float. However you can't use it purely as a list object. Pathfinder Sorcerer Spells, Phd Health Services Research Salary, Buxus Hedge Plants, Insanity Flyff Templar Build, 2000s R&b Artists, Organic Wheat Bran Bulk, " />

# python a range of float

